openSUSE Leap 15.3: 2022:0190-1 Important: Polkit Privilege Escalation

The recent update for openSUSE resolves a critical local privilege escalation vulnerability found in polkit, significantly bolstering system security.
An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available

Description

This update for polkit fixes the following issues:

- CVE-2021-4034: Fixed a local privilege escalation in pkexec

(bsc#1194568).

Patch

Patch Instructions:

To install this openSU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ation methods

like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".

Alternatively you can run the command listed for your product:

- openSUSE Leap 15.3:

zypper in -t patch openSUSE-SLE-15.3-2022-190=1
